ActiveOberon
Parser and code browser for the ActiveOberon language (original version from 2004) (by rochus-keller)
AOS_Bluebottle_Sources
This is the source code of the last stable release of the ETH AOS/Bluebottle System, dated March 12, 2004, in plain ISO 8859-1 UTF-8 text files (by OberonSystem3)

Project Oberon the Design of an Operating System, a Compiler, and a Computer Pdf
The Active Oberon evolution started with the Active Object System (AOS) with the Bluebottle window manager; the source code of the last "Current" version can be accessed e.g. here: https://github.com/OberonSystem3/AOS_Bluebottle_Sources. If you want to study the source code, you can use this tool: https://github.com/Rochus-Keller/ActiveOberon.
